<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> 一種智能無(wú)線(xiàn)多媒體數字播放系統的設計方案

一種智能無(wú)線(xiàn)多媒體數字播放系統的設計方案

作者: 時(shí)間:2011-07-12 來(lái)源:網(wǎng)絡(luò ) 收藏

  圖3中驅動(dòng)程序的struct file_operations( )只使用了提供的4個(gè)子函數接口:open( )、write( )、ioctl( )和release( )。其中open( )用于完成SPI設備的打開(kāi)、初始化相關(guān)寄存器、準備進(jìn)行設備I/O操作;write( )完成通過(guò)SPI接口進(jìn)行寫(xiě)操作;ioctl( )是進(jìn)行讀寫(xiě)以外的其他操作,通過(guò)對I/O口高低電平的改變實(shí)現不同功能;release( )用于關(guān)閉設備,釋放占用內存[12]。

  S3C2440A SPI的傳輸形式是由SPI控制寄存器SPCON中的1 bit位和2 bit位的值共同決定的。1 bit位是CPHA(Clock Phrase Select),它用來(lái)選擇傳輸格式為Format A或Format B,置0為Format A,置1為Format B;2 bit位是CPOL(Clock Polarity),它決定時(shí)鐘信號是高電平觸發(fā)還是低電平觸發(fā),置0為active high,置1為active low。由圖3可以看出,CYWUSB6934的SPI單字節讀出時(shí)鐘是高電平觸發(fā)的,又如虛線(xiàn)箭頭處時(shí)鐘信號的上升沿正與圖4中SPI時(shí)鐘相吻合,而在圖4中cmd的2 bit位是傳輸字節中的最高2位,再根據圖5中 MOSI的MSB就應該是傳輸字節的最高2位,為00,所以選擇方式為Format A高電平觸發(fā)。

  在確定了它們之間的傳輸格式以及觸發(fā)方式后, SPI驅動(dòng)的實(shí)現就是對這些寄存器進(jìn)行正確的賦值。收發(fā)芯片CYWUSB6934通過(guò)SPI接口與ARM9主控芯片進(jìn)行通信,需要對各個(gè)寄存器進(jìn)行設置。根據要求,使用SPI1口實(shí)現SPI通信,其具體的編程實(shí)現如下:



評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>